これまでに、多くの方々に学んでいただいております C言語講座。
ここではその内容をご案内いたします。
C言語 とは
C言語は、AT&T ベル研究所のケン・トンプソンが開発したB言語を、デニス・リッチーが改良して誕生したプログラミング言語です。
制御構文などに高水準言語の特徴を持ちながら、ハードウェア寄りの記述も可能な低水準言語の特徴も併せ持っています。
ブライアン・カーニハンとデニス・リッチーによって書かれた名著「プログラミング言語C」は、著者の名前を取って「K&R」とも呼ばれ、長い間リファレンス的な扱いを受けて来ました。初学者が最初に学ぶプログラム「Hello World」は定番となっています。
基幹系システムや、動作環境の資源制約が厳しい、あるいは実行速度性能が要求されるソフトウェアの開発など、企業でのアプリケーション開発や、また、アセンブラとの親和性が高いために、ハードウェアに密着したコーディングがやりやすい、小さな資源で動く実行プログラムを作りやすいことから、PICマイコンを使った電子工作などにも用いられています。
他の高級言語ではあまり意識することのないハードウェアのメモリやポインタなどを理解可能なことから、初学者が最初に学ぶプログラミング言語としても人気があります。
テキストも、図解で分かりやすいものを選んでありますので、お子様が最初に学ぶプログラミング言語としてもお薦めです。
学習内容
C言語講座では、プログラミングとは何か? から始まり、ご自身で簡単なアプリケーションを作成できるよう、様々なことを学びます。
C言語 入門
- 開発環境整備
- 基本的なプログラム
- 演算子
- 制御文
- 配列とポインタ
- 関数
- ファイルの入出力
- 構造体
対面での講座
プログラミングを習得されたいあなたへ向けて、独学で学べる多数のオンライン講座もございますが、分からない点、疑問点を気軽に聞ける対面での講座は、学習意欲の維持や技術習得の観点からとてもお勧めです。
遠方の方には、ビデオ通話と画面共有ソフトを用いた遠隔でのご指導もいたしておりますので、お気軽にお声掛け下さい。
学びの形
先生が前に立ち、生徒は机に座って、授業を受ける。分からない点があっても質問できず四苦八苦してしまう。よくあるパソコン教室での学びはこのようになりがちです。
もっと気軽に情報技術(IT)やプログラミングを学んで欲しい。そんな想いから喫茶店等での個人指導を中心に行っています。ちょうど家庭教師のような、あるいは共に技術向上を目指す仲間のような意識を持っていただければと思っております。お友達や、会社、サークルの仲間達とご一緒に公共施設や会議室を借りてのグループレッスンも行っております。
こんな方が学んでいます
大学受験に活かしたい高校生の方〜在宅でお仕事をなさりたい主婦の方、お仕事に活かしたい社会人の方や、定年後の新しい趣味として学んでみたい方など、10代〜60代まで、老若男女、様々な方が学んでいます。
学習期間
学習期間ですが、週一回二時間、おおよそ二ヶ月を目安にしていただければと思います。
週二回学びたい、土日に纏めてやりたい、など対応させていただきますので、お気軽にご相談ください。
学習費用
学習費用ですが、街中のプログラミング教室ですと、十数万円から数十万円をかけて、二〜三ヶ月通学して技術を習得するところもございます。
多くの方々に学んでいただきたいとの思いから、なるべくお財布に負担をかけずに学習していただければと思っておりますので、ご安心ください。いつでも使える回数券もご用意いたしております。ご予算に応じてご相談可能ですので、お気軽にどうぞお問い合わせください。
お近くの喫茶店でミニ講座も
喫茶店等で、お打ち合わせや、ミニ講座も行っております。
ご質問やご希望など、いろいろお聞かせください。
良き出逢いになればと期待いたしております。
テキストはこちら